The award-winning Oceanarium is the perfect all weather attraction - discover the mysterious beauty of our watery world in a spectacular underwater journey.
From stunning sharks, curious rare green sea turtles and brightly coloured clownfish, to menacing piranhas, venomous lionfish and the weirdly wonderful octopus – they are all waiting to be discovered!
Be enchanted by the latest additions to the Oceanarium, a very cute Oriental small clawed otter family! Set in a lush bamboo forest with rocky pools and flowing streams, watch them swim, splash, feed and play in their exotic, naturally themed oasis.
Experience the world's first virtual Interactive Dive Cage and take a magnificent adventure without getting wet.... Then discover the interactive Global Meltdown to unveil the potential effects of climate change.

Located next to Bournemouth Pier, on the beach front, just a 5 minute walk from the town centre.

Road Directions
Nearest major road is A35. A338 Wessex Way follow signs.
The nearest pay and display car parks are located just a few minutes walk away from the Oceanarium: Bath Road South, Bath Road North and the BIC car park.
Coaches can drop off their passengers in the turning area behind the Oceanarium, next to the BIC, just a minute walk from the Oceanarium
Public Transport Directions
Nearest station is Bournemouth. Follow signs to Bournemouth Seafront and Pier.
